
| Snakes | The Edo people of Benin City believe that snakes consume and destroy illness. |
| Crocodiles | The Edo people of Benin believe that the crocodile symbolizes power. The king or Oba is able to crush opposition like crocodile crushes its prey. |
| Chevrons | Chevrons symbolize rain or water to the Dogon of Mali. |
| Bird | To the Edo people of Benin, the bird symbolizes the king's power to overcome false prophets and fortunetellers. |
| Stool | To the Dogon peoples of Mali, the stool symbolizes dignity and authority. |
| Navel | The people of the Congo believe that the navel is a focus and release point of strong emotions. |
| Bared teeth | Bared teeth generally symbolize ferocity and aggression |
| Round hollow Eyes | Round hollow eyes symbolize the ability to project penetrating inner powers. |
| Half-closed eyes | Half-closed eyes symbolize contemplation. |
